Interest rates charged by banks are usually much lower than rates charged by other loan providers. As profit margins tend to be slim on small-business loans, banks try to reduce their danger as much as possible. This means that you will require to present a total loan bundle, consisting of a personal monetary statement, copies of individual income tax return and often even a business strategy. Banks also tend to provide loans just to little businesses with collateral and an individual warranty from the owner. Regional banks may be much better alternatives since they understand the regional credit conditions. They often offer more access to a loan officer and put more emphasis on a borrower's character instead of simply the credit report.
The SBA doesn't release these loans directly. Rather, an authorized lender makes the loan, with the SBA ensuring a part of it, lowering much of the threat for the lending institution. The SBA offers various types of loans, of which the 7( a) loan program is the most popular. These loans can be used for a range of functions working capital, buying a franchise or refinancing debt. Receivable financing is a typical source of money for services that earn money long after they deliver their products or services.
The rates of interest for receivable funding is high compared to conventional bank loans, however getting the financing is fairly fast. So if you need a quick influx of cash, invoice funding can be a great short-term option when you wish to avoid lengthier loan applications. A lot of all sources of financing or credit have actually pertained to rely on a four-letter word to score your credit merit: FICO. FICO is a numerical approach, utilizing simply 3 digits, to anticipate the likelihood of paying your credit as agreed. FICO scores vary from 365 (not great) to a high of 850 (terrific). Ball game evaluates your credit payment history, number of open accounts, general credit balances and public records such as judgments and liens - How to finance a car from a private seller. Usually, a FICO rating above 680 will produce a favorable response while a score listed below this will cause a lender to be careful. Prior to seeking funding or credit, it is an excellent concept to know where your FICO rating stands.
